/**
 * Simple implementation of the {@link AliasRegistry} interface.
 * Serves as base class for
 * {@link org.springframework.beans.factory.support.BeanDefinitionRegistry}
 * implementations.
 *
 * @author Juergen Hoeller
 * @since 2.5.2
 */
public class SimpleAliasRegistry implements AliasRegistry {

	/** Logger available to subclasses. */
	protected final Log logger = LogFactory.getLog(getClass());

	/** Map from alias to canonical name. */
	private final Map aliasMap = new ConcurrentHashMap<>(16);


	@Override
	public void registerAlias(String name, String alias) {
		Assert.hasText(name, "'name' must not be empty");
		Assert.hasText(alias, "'alias' must not be empty");
		synchronized (this.aliasMap) {
			if (alias.equals(name)) {
				this.aliasMap.remove(alias);
				if (logger.isDebugEnabled()) {
					logger.debug("Alias definition '" + alias + "' ignored since it points to same name");
				}
			}
			else {
				String registeredName = this.aliasMap.get(alias);
				if (registeredName != null) {
					if (registeredName.equals(name)) {
						// An existing alias - no need to re-register
						return;
					}
					if (!allowAliasOverriding()) {
						throw new IllegalStateException("Cannot define alias '" + alias + "' for name '" +
								name + "': It is already registered for name '" + registeredName + "'.");
					}
					if (logger.isDebugEnabled()) {
						logger.debug("Overriding alias '" + alias + "' definition for registered name '" +
								registeredName + "' with new target name '" + name + "'");
					}
				}
				checkForAliasCircle(name, alias);
				this.aliasMap.put(alias, name);
				if (logger.isTraceEnabled()) {
					logger.trace("Alias definition '" + alias + "' registered for name '" + name + "'");
				}
			}
		}
	}

	/**
	 * Return whether alias overriding is allowed.
	 * Default is {@code true}.
	 */
	protected boolean allowAliasOverriding() {
		return true;
	}

	/**
	 * Determine whether the given name has the given alias registered.
	 * @param name the name to check
	 * @param alias the alias to look for
	 * @since 4.2.1
	 */
	public boolean hasAlias(String name, String alias) {
		for (Map.Entry entry : this.aliasMap.entrySet()) {
			String registeredName = entry.getValue();
			if (registeredName.equals(name)) {
				String registeredAlias = entry.getKey();
				if (registeredAlias.equals(alias) || hasAlias(registeredAlias, alias)) {
					return true;
				}
			}
		}
		return false;
	}

	@Override
	public void removeAlias(String alias) {
		synchronized (this.aliasMap) {
			String name = this.aliasMap.remove(alias);
			if (name == null) {
				throw new IllegalStateException("No alias '" + alias + "' registered");
			}
		}
	}

	@Override
	public boolean isAlias(String name) {
		return this.aliasMap.containsKey(name);
	}

	@Override
	public String[] getAliases(String name) {
		List result = new ArrayList<>();
		synchronized (this.aliasMap) {
			retrieveAliases(name, result);
		}
		return StringUtils.toStringArray(result);
	}

	/**
	 * Transitively retrieve all aliases for the given name.
	 * @param name the target name to find aliases for
	 * @param result the resulting aliases list
	 */
	private void retrieveAliases(String name, List result) {
		this.aliasMap.forEach((alias, registeredName) -> {
			if (registeredName.equals(name)) {
				result.add(alias);
				retrieveAliases(alias, result);
			}
		});
	}
